Trainers go through a rigorous and exacting program of coursework and examinations to get certified by one of the respected athletic fitness associations. Their course studies include anatomy, cardio and pulmonary systems, the skeleton and skeletal structures. Musculature is studied in depth from the muscle cell to the major muscles groups in the thighs, back, shoulders and chest. Joint health and ways to combat debilitating joint deterioration are also part of the curriculum. All this coursework is the subject of examinations designed to ensure a full understanding of the body and its functioning.

Personal trainers are required to take CPR courses every two years and are prepared if a cardio or pulmonary emergency arises. These courses are hands on and are generally taught by medical personnel or emergency medical technicians. The techniques are practiced until they become an automatic response.

Trainers also are required to finish continuing education coursework to keep them abreast of the most current exercise and health information. The certifying agencies keep track of this continuing education. These agencies also provide workshops and fitness conventions as part of the ongoing education of their licensees.

It’s easy to find a personal trainer. If you belong to a health club, there will be several on the staff. Frequently membership fees include one or two sessions but these trainers are always walking around the gym ready to help. There’s usually one in every gym who really enjoys helping people who want to learn and considers that a part of his job at the club.

If you don’t belong to a gym, then contact one of the certifying agencies. You can find them online. They’ll give you a list of trainers in your area.

Depending on your age, health and physical condition, it may be essential that you check with your doctor before beginning training. The personal trainer has evaluation sheets to help determine if this is necessary. The first session you have with her will involve a lot of information gathering and assessment of your current condition. She will want to know your goals and what type of exercise you enjoy. Armed with this information she will be able to create a training program that you’ll enjoy doing. With the right attitude and a good trainer, you can meet and exceed your fitness goals.
